Miami-Dade County Public Schools (M-DCPS) has been closely monitoring Hurricane Milton's track and has been working directly with the National Weather Service and Miami-Dade Office of Emergency Management.
After consultation with the County's emergency officials, Schools Superintendent Dr. Jose L. Dotres has suspended all M-DCPS school-related activitiesinclusive of adult education as of 6 p.m., Tuesday, October 8, 2024. After-school care will remain open, but parents are encouraged to pick up their children as early as possible.
In addition, classes at all M-DCPS schools have been cancelled on Wednesday, October 9, 2024. This includes adult education, school-based after-care programs, activities and athletic events.
